Minardi sends warning to Mercedes' rivals
Article To news overview © minardi.it Giancarlo Minardi, founder of the Minardi F1 team, has urged fans not to get too carried away by Mercedes's early struggles in the 2021 season, as they have shown a remarkable ability to bounce back from adversity in recent years. At last weekend's Bahrain Grand Prix, it was Red Bull who looked to have the beating of the seven-time world champions. However, mistakes from the Austrian team, as well as an inspired drive from Lewis Hamilton, saw Mercedes leave with the race win - and an early lead in the constructor standings.
